From e0b64e4041e84186bafd4326daebdd82a7d43467 Mon Sep 17 00:00:00 2001 From: olli Date: Wed, 30 Nov 2022 16:00:14 +0100 Subject: [PATCH] better error reporting --- docker.yml |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/docker.yml b/docker.yml index d3db909..e1409cb 100644 --- a/docker.yml +++ b/docker.yml @@ -74,17 +74,17 @@ if docker-compose --log-level WARNING --no-ansi pull --include-deps 2>&1 | grep "download complete" then g_echo_warn "Installiere $docker Update" - docker-compose --log-level WARNING --no-ansi down 2>&1 || g_echo_error "$docker: docker-compose pull fehlgeschlagen" - docker-compose --log-level WARNING --no-ansi up -d 2>&1 || g_echo_error "$docker: docker-compose up fehlgeschlagen" + docker-compose --log-level WARNING --no-ansi down >$g_tmp/down 2>&1 || g_echo_error "$docker: docker-compose pull fehlgeschlagen: $(cat $g_tmp/down)" + docker-compose --log-level WARNING --no-ansi up -d >$g_tmp/up 2>&1 || g_echo_error "$docker: docker-compose up fehlgeschlagen: $(cat $g_tmp/up)" fi if [ -f Dockerfile ] then - if docker-compose --log-level WARNING --no-ansi build --pull --no-cache --force-rm + if docker-compose --log-level WARNING --no-ansi build --pull --no-cache --force-rm >$g_tmp/build 2>&1 then - docker-compose --log-level WARNING --no-ansi down || g_echo_error "$docker: docker-compose pull fehlgeschlagen" - docker-compose --log-level WARNING --no-ansi up -d || g_echo_error "$docker: docker-compose up fehlgeschlagen" + docker-compose --log-level WARNING --no-ansi down >$g_tmp/down 2>&1 || g_echo_error "$docker: docker-compose pull fehlgeschlagen: $(cat $g_tmp/down)" + docker-compose --log-level WARNING --no-ansi up -d >$g_tmp/up 2>&1 || g_echo_error "$docker: docker-compose up fehlgeschlagen: $(cat $g_tmp/up)" else - g_echo_error "$docker: docker-compose build fehlgeschlagen" + g_echo_error "$docker: docker-compose build fehlgeschlagen: $(cat $g_tmp/build)" fi fi done